What kinds of problems can Alexander Technique help with?
- Back pain - low, middle or upper, particularly posture-related
- Neck pain and stiffness (due to general poor use, over use or even neck injuries such as whiplash etc.
- Heavy, sluggish posture
- Tight, held, upright posture
- General body discomfort
- Shallow breathing
- Posture-related asthma
- Stress - difficulty coping with stressful conditions
- Some joint problems - including Repetitive Strain Injury (R.S.I.)
- Some knee problems
- Some hip problems
- Sciatic problems
- Some problems relating to stiffness in movement
- Some balance problems
- Improving performance in singing, playing an instrument, horse riding etc
- Poor self/body-awareness
